Clarifying the SMART Framework for Leadership Goals

Undeniably, I’m about to delve into the SMART framework, an essential tool for setting successful leadership growth goals. This acronym stands for Specific, Measurable, Achievable, Relevant, and Time-bound.

These components ensure that your leadership goals are clear, trackable, and within reach while aligning with your objectives and time limits.

For goals for leaders examples, consider a team leader who aims to boost her team’s productivity by 15% in the next quarter. She’s set development goals that are specific (increase productivity), measurable goals (by 15%), achievable (with the right strategies), relevant (to her role as a team lead), and time-bound (in the next quarter).

SMART Leadership Goals to Elevate Your Leadership Game

Chess on stairs

Let’s talk about how these goals can help you level up your leadership game.

We’ll focus on three main areas:

  1. Enhancing communication skills: Effective communication is essential for leadership success. Setting SMART goals that focus on improving communication skills can help you become a more articulate and persuasive communicator in one-on-one and group settings.
  2. Developing emotional intelligence: Emotional intelligence is the ability to understand and manage your own emotions, as well as the emotions of others. By setting SMART goals to develop emotional intelligence, you can become more empathetic, build stronger relationships, and make better decisions based on emotional awareness.
  3. Nurturing a feedback-rich environment: Feedback is crucial for personal and professional growth. As a leader, creating a culture that values and encourages feedback can help foster continuous improvement and innovation.
    Setting SMART goals to create a feedback-rich environment can involve implementing regular feedback sessions, providing constructive feedback to team members, and actively seeking feedback from others.

Each of these factors plays a crucial role in becoming a more effective and respected leader. By setting SMART goals in these areas, you can take intentional steps toward improving your skills and achieving your full potential.

Frequently Asked Questions

What Are Some Common Mistakes to Avoid When Setting Leadership Advancement Goals?

In my experience, common mistakes when establishing leadership goals include being too vague, not considering the team’s needs, setting unrealistic timelines, and neglecting to regularly track and reassess the progress.

How Can One Measure the Success or Progress of Their Leadership Advancement Goals?

To measure the success of my leadership advancement goals, I’d track specific metrics like improved communication skills, increased team productivity, or positive feedback from colleagues. It’s about tangible results and personal growth indicators.

Are There Specific Personality Traits That Can Hinder or Enhance the Achievement of Leadership Advancement Goals?

Certain personality traits can either enhance or impede my leadership enhancement. Traits like empathy, resilience, and assertiveness can promote progress, while traits like arrogance or lack of confidence hinder it.

Can Leadership Advancement Goals Be Applied to Personal Life Situations Outside of a Professional Setting?

I can apply leadership advancement goals to my personal life. They’re not just for professional settings. They can enhance interpersonal skills, decision-making abilities, and confidence, which are valuable in every aspect of life.

How Can an Organization Support Its Employees in Achieving Their Leadership Advancement Goals?

As an organizational leader, I’d foster a supportive environment, offer training programs, provide mentorship opportunities, and encourage goal-setting. It’s vital to invest in your team’s growth and help them achieve their leadership advancement goals.
